Nikoloz Tskitishvili - Telebasket.com

Georgian, started playing with Sukhumi, in his native country, where he played in 1997-98 and 1998-99. Signed for the 1999-00 season by KD Slovan (Slovenia), has played there also in 2000-01. Signed for the 2001-02 season by Pallacanestro Treviso (Italy), making his debut in January.Selected at the 2002 NBA Draft by the Denver Nuggets ( 1st round # 5 pick overall).

Member of the Georgian National Team at the 1999 European Championship for Cadets and at 2000 European Junior Championship Qualifying round. Played the 1999-00 Slovenian All Star Game.Won the 2001-02 Italian National Championship.

Physical, tall and reasonably strong, his body structure is still light and undeveloped..........however, despite the fact that his muscles have not yet reached their final shape, his athletic abilities are good enough.........he's very fast and agile for his size..........good leaper with relative shrewdness..........Nickoloz's psychological stability allows him to play his game even under stress and tension..........he is a player who can do almost everything; shoot threes, rebound, handle the ball and pass it around, but he still has to adjust his skills for the senior level..........he's very good playing one-on-one, where he is always either taller, stronger or faster than his opponents..........his moves under the opponent's basket are resourceful and fast..........while on offense, he prefers to receive the ball on the perimeter, facing the basket, to penetrate and dunk, even over the defense..........down low he slides quickly along the baseline for a power move or a reverse shot..........in addition to the points made near the basket he can also score from long range distance, even outside the arc..........good free throws shooter..........rebounds well..........an organized defense can put him completely out of the game..........on defense he likes to block shots, but that's about it..........experienced players can get around him or draw a foul easily..........nevertheless he has great defensive potential, but still lacks some confidence..........he's very quick and stable, and when these qualities are under control, we'll see his defensive game improve a lot..........potential, potential, potential!.........here is a great talent with lot of upsides..........some say he doesn't like to work much..........he needs coaching at good level and to put some weight on..........has structure and quickness to be even a small forward, and he's definitely an excellent investment for the future for any top level team..........he is controlled by KK Olimpija Ljubljana.
